    A lovely birthday dinner at Porch and Parlor. This was my first visit and I was very pleased with the hospitality of the staff. The valet is on the side of the restaurant and it is complimentary. The front desk staff and greeter/hostess were all very nice and friendly. My friends and I were seated on the covered patio, it was chilly outside, but the covered patio has heaters and it stayed warm once staff made sure the patio door to leave stayed closed. We were seated next to the area where the waitstaff go in and out, it wasn't bad, I'd just ask to be seated elsewhere due to the constant in and out traffic. Now what did we order you ask?? Boneless Ribeye NY Strip Filet Cream brûlée corn (Absolutely delicious) Creamed spinach( very good) Brussel sprouts ( I had one Brussel sprout.. if you like them order them) Loaded potatoes ( similar to potatoes au gratin but fancier ) Mac and cheese Collard greens(sugar in the greens to cut the bitterness but too much sugar for my liking) Bacon Flight if you love bacon...order it! Don't question if it's good because it will be delicious. Chopped salad( it was ok, different ingredients than your normal garden salad, but good combination) has black eyed peas and celery if you're not a fan . Strawberry shortcake Everyone enjoyed the meal and sides. The sides are family style. The menu is à la carte if ordering steaks, they do offer entrees that come with sides that can be substituted for a fee. Mocktail menu offered along with cocktails and wine. The entire experience from valet, hostess, greeter, waitress, manager, everyone was so pleasant. I'd definitely return. Oh we also had the egg rolls, the sauce is a Thai style chili sauce. They were my least favorite because of the sweetness of the sauce but everyone else enjoyed them.

    Is this local or chain?

    This is locally owned by The Flight Group. They also own Southern Social, Flight and Coastal Fish Company.
